Home
last modified time | relevance | path

Searched refs:timeNanoSec (Results 1 - 25 of 27) sorted by relevance

12

/foundation/multimedia/audio_framework/services/audio_service/test/example/
H A Daudio_hdi_device_test.cpp65 int64_t timeNanoSec = 0; in RenderFrameFromFile() local
76 hdiRenderSink_->GetMmapHandlePosition(frameCount, timeSec, timeNanoSec); in RenderFrameFromFile()
77 int64_t temp = timeNanoSec + timeSec * AUDIO_NS_PER_SECOND; in RenderFrameFromFile()
/foundation/multimedia/audio_framework/frameworks/native/hdiadapter/sink/fast/
H A Dfast_audio_renderer_sink.cpp97 int32_t GetPresentationPosition(uint64_t& frames, int64_t& timeSec, int64_t& timeNanoSec) override;
101 int32_t GetMmapHandlePosition(uint64_t &frames, int64_t &timeSec, int64_t &timeNanoSec) override;
316 int32_t FastAudioRendererSinkInner::GetMmapHandlePosition(uint64_t &frames, int64_t &timeSec, int64_t &timeNanoSec) in GetMmapHandlePosition() argument
338 timeNanoSec = timestamp.tvNSec; in GetMmapHandlePosition()
522 int64_t timeNanoSec = 0; in PreparePosition() local
523 GetMmapHandlePosition(frames, timeSec, timeNanoSec); // get first start position in PreparePosition()
607 int64_t timeNanoSec = 0; in CheckPositionTime() local
612 int32_t ret = GetMmapHandlePosition(frames, timeSec, timeNanoSec); in CheckPositionTime()
616 if (ret != SUCCESS || curSec != timeSec || curNanoSec - timeNanoSec > maxHandleCost) { in CheckPositionTime()
619 tryCount, ret, curSec, curNanoSec, timeSec, timeNanoSec); in CheckPositionTime()
782 GetPresentationPosition(uint64_t& frames, int64_t& timeSec, int64_t& timeNanoSec) GetPresentationPosition() argument
[all...]
/foundation/multimedia/audio_framework/frameworks/native/hdiadapter/source/fast/
H A Dfast_audio_capturer_source.cpp67 int32_t GetPresentationPosition(uint64_t& frames, int64_t& timeSec, int64_t& timeNanoSec) override;
74 int32_t GetMmapHandlePosition(uint64_t &frames, int64_t &timeSec, int64_t &timeNanoSec) override;
384 int32_t FastAudioCapturerSourceInner::GetMmapHandlePosition(uint64_t &frames, int64_t &timeSec, int64_t &timeNanoSec) in GetMmapHandlePosition() argument
398 timeNanoSec = timestamp.tvNSec; in GetMmapHandlePosition()
492 int64_t timeNanoSec = 0; in CheckPositionTime() local
497 int32_t ret = GetMmapHandlePosition(frames, timeSec, timeNanoSec); in CheckPositionTime()
501 if (ret != SUCCESS || curSec != timeSec || curNanoSec - timeNanoSec > maxHandleCost) { in CheckPositionTime()
504 tryCount, ret, curSec, curNanoSec, timeSec, timeNanoSec); in CheckPositionTime()
685 int32_t FastAudioCapturerSourceInner::GetPresentationPosition(uint64_t& frames, int64_t& timeSec, int64_t& timeNanoSec) in GetPresentationPosition() argument
/foundation/multimedia/audio_framework/frameworks/native/hdiadapter/sink/common/
H A Di_audio_renderer_sink.h88 virtual int32_t GetPresentationPosition(uint64_t &frames, int64_t &timeSec, int64_t &timeNanoSec) = 0;
125 virtual int32_t GetMmapHandlePosition(uint64_t &frames, int64_t &timeSec, int64_t &timeNanoSec) = 0;
H A Di_audio_renderer_sink_intf.h57 int64_t* timeSec, int64_t* timeNanoSec);
87 int64_t* timeSec, int64_t* timeNanoSec);
H A Di_audio_renderer_sink.cpp275 int64_t *timeSec, int64_t *timeNanoSec) in IAudioRendererSinkGetPresentationPosition()
284 return audioRendererSink->GetPresentationPosition(*frames, *timeSec, *timeNanoSec); in IAudioRendererSinkGetPresentationPosition()
274 IAudioRendererSinkGetPresentationPosition(struct RendererSinkAdapter *adapter, uint64_t *frames, int64_t *timeSec, int64_t *timeNanoSec) IAudioRendererSinkGetPresentationPosition() argument
/foundation/multimedia/audio_framework/frameworks/native/hdiadapter/source/common/
H A Di_audio_capturer_source.h93 virtual int32_t GetPresentationPosition(uint64_t& frames, int64_t& timeSec, int64_t& timeNanoSec) = 0;
123 virtual int32_t GetMmapHandlePosition(uint64_t &frames, int64_t &timeSec, int64_t &timeNanoSec) = 0;
/foundation/multimedia/audio_framework/frameworks/native/hdiadapter/source/remote_fast/
H A Dremote_fast_audio_capturer_source.cpp81 int32_t GetPresentationPosition(uint64_t& frames, int64_t& timeSec, int64_t& timeNanoSec) override;
88 int32_t GetMmapHandlePosition(uint64_t &frames, int64_t &timeSec, int64_t &timeNanoSec) override;
423 int64_t &timeNanoSec) in GetMmapHandlePosition()
438 timeNanoSec = timestamp.tvNSec; in GetMmapHandlePosition()
462 int64_t timeNanoSec = 0; in CheckPositionTime() local
467 int32_t ret = GetMmapHandlePosition(frames, timeSec, timeNanoSec); in CheckPositionTime()
471 if (ret != SUCCESS || curSec != timeSec || curNanoSec - timeNanoSec > maxHandleCost) { in CheckPositionTime()
645 int64_t& timeNanoSec) in GetPresentationPosition()
422 GetMmapHandlePosition(uint64_t &frames, int64_t &timeSec, int64_t &timeNanoSec) GetMmapHandlePosition() argument
644 GetPresentationPosition(uint64_t& frames, int64_t& timeSec, int64_t& timeNanoSec) GetPresentationPosition() argument
/foundation/multimedia/audio_framework/frameworks/native/hdiadapter/sink/remote_fast/
H A Dremote_fast_audio_renderer_sink.cpp105 int32_t GetPresentationPosition(uint64_t& frames, int64_t& timeSec, int64_t& timeNanoSec) override;
110 int32_t GetMmapHandlePosition(uint64_t &frames, int64_t &timeSec, int64_t &timeNanoSec) override;
373 int64_t &timeNanoSec) in GetMmapHandlePosition()
389 timeNanoSec = timestamp.tvNSec; in GetMmapHandlePosition()
478 int64_t timeNanoSec = 0; in CheckPositionTime() local
483 int32_t ret = GetMmapHandlePosition(frames, timeSec, timeNanoSec); in CheckPositionTime()
487 if (ret != SUCCESS || curSec != timeSec || curNanoSec - timeNanoSec > maxHandleCost) { in CheckPositionTime()
710 int64_t& timeNanoSec) in GetPresentationPosition()
372 GetMmapHandlePosition(uint64_t &frames, int64_t &timeSec, int64_t &timeNanoSec) GetMmapHandlePosition() argument
709 GetPresentationPosition(uint64_t& frames, int64_t& timeSec, int64_t& timeNanoSec) GetPresentationPosition() argument
/foundation/multimedia/audio_framework/frameworks/native/hdiadapter/source/file/
H A Daudio_capturer_file_source.h51 int32_t GetPresentationPosition(uint64_t& frames, int64_t& timeSec, int64_t& timeNanoSec) override;
H A Daudio_capturer_file_source.cpp94 int32_t AudioCapturerFileSource::GetPresentationPosition(uint64_t& frames, int64_t& timeSec, int64_t& timeNanoSec) in GetPresentationPosition() argument
/foundation/multimedia/audio_framework/frameworks/native/hdiadapter/sink/bluetooth/
H A Dbluetooth_renderer_sink.cpp106 int32_t GetPresentationPosition(uint64_t& frames, int64_t& timeSec, int64_t& timeNanoSec) override;
162 int32_t GetMmapHandlePosition(uint64_t &frames, int64_t &timeSec, int64_t &timeNanoSec) override;
717 int64_t timeNanoSec = 0; in CheckPositionTime() local
720 int32_t ret = GetMmapHandlePosition(frames, timeSec, timeNanoSec); in CheckPositionTime()
724 if (ret != SUCCESS || curSec != timeSec || curNanoSec - timeNanoSec > MAX_GET_POSITION_HANDLE_TIME) { in CheckPositionTime()
948 int32_t BluetoothRendererSinkInner::GetPresentationPosition(uint64_t& frames, int64_t& timeSec, int64_t& timeNanoSec) in GetPresentationPosition() argument
1090 int32_t BluetoothRendererSinkInner::GetMmapHandlePosition(uint64_t &frames, int64_t &timeSec, int64_t &timeNanoSec) in GetMmapHandlePosition() argument
1104 timeNanoSec = timestamp.tvNSec; in GetMmapHandlePosition()
/foundation/multimedia/audio_framework/frameworks/native/hdiadapter/sink/file/
H A Daudio_renderer_file_sink.h62 int32_t GetPresentationPosition(uint64_t& frames, int64_t& timeSec, int64_t& timeNanoSec) override;
H A Daudio_renderer_file_sink.cpp107 int32_t AudioRendererFileSink::GetPresentationPosition(uint64_t& frames, int64_t& timeSec, int64_t& timeNanoSec) in GetPresentationPosition() argument
/foundation/multimedia/audio_framework/test/fuzztest/audioadaptorbluetooth_fuzzer/
H A Daudio_adaptor_bluetooth_fuzzer.cpp247 int64_t timeNanoSec = COMMON_INT64_NUM; in GetPresentationPositionFuzzTest() local
248 GetAdaptorBlueToothSink()->GetPresentationPosition(frames, timeSec, timeNanoSec); in GetPresentationPositionFuzzTest()
/foundation/multimedia/audio_framework/services/audio_service/server/src/
H A Daudio_endpoint_separate.cpp632 int64_t timeNanoSec = 0; in GetDeviceHandleInfo() local
640 ret = fastSink_->GetMmapHandlePosition(frames, timeSec, timeNanoSec); in GetDeviceHandleInfo()
646 nanoTime = timeNanoSec + timeSec * AUDIO_NS_PER_SECOND; in GetDeviceHandleInfo()
H A Dpa_renderer_stream_impl.cpp1016 int32_t PaRendererStreamImpl::OffloadGetPresentationPosition(uint64_t& frames, int64_t& timeSec, int64_t& timeNanoSec) in OffloadGetPresentationPosition() argument
1022 return audioRendererSinkInstance->GetPresentationPosition(frames, timeSec, timeNanoSec); in OffloadGetPresentationPosition()
1073 int64_t timeNanoSec = 0; in GetOffloadApproximatelyCacheTime() local
1074 OffloadGetPresentationPosition(frames, timeSec, timeNanoSec); in GetOffloadApproximatelyCacheTime()
1076 static_cast<int64_t>(timeSec * AUDIO_US_PER_SECOND + timeNanoSec / AUDIO_NS_PER_US); in GetOffloadApproximatelyCacheTime()
H A Daudio_endpoint.cpp1814 int64_t timeNanoSec = 0; in GetDeviceHandleInfo() local
1820 ret = fastSource_->GetMmapHandlePosition(frames, timeSec, timeNanoSec); in GetDeviceHandleInfo()
1825 ret = fastSink_->GetMmapHandlePosition(frames, timeSec, timeNanoSec); in GetDeviceHandleInfo()
1829 nanoTime = timeNanoSec + timeSec * AUDIO_NS_PER_SECOND; in GetDeviceHandleInfo()
/foundation/multimedia/audio_framework/frameworks/native/hdiadapter/sink/offload/
H A Doffload_audio_renderer_sink.cpp111 int32_t GetPresentationPosition(uint64_t& frames, int64_t& timeSec, int64_t& timeNanoSec) override;
414 int32_t OffloadAudioRendererSinkInner::GetPresentationPosition(uint64_t& frames, int64_t& timeSec, int64_t& timeNanoSec) in GetPresentationPosition() argument
431 timeNanoSec = timestamp.tvNSec; in GetPresentationPosition()
807 int64_t timeNanoSec = 0; in GetLatency() local
808 CHECK_AND_RETURN_RET_LOG(GetPresentationPosition(frames, timeSec, timeNanoSec) == SUCCESS, ERR_OPERATION_FAILED, in GetLatency()
/foundation/multimedia/audio_framework/services/audio_service/server/include/
H A Dpa_renderer_stream_impl.h90 int32_t OffloadGetPresentationPosition(uint64_t& frames, int64_t& timeSec, int64_t& timeNanoSec);
/foundation/multimedia/audio_framework/services/audio_service/test/unittest/
H A Daudio_direct_sink_unit_test.cpp453 int64_t timeNanoSec = 10; in HWTEST_F() local
454 int32_t ret = sink->GetPresentationPosition(frame, timeSec, timeNanoSec); in HWTEST_F()
472 ret = sink->GetPresentationPosition(frame, timeSec, timeNanoSec); in HWTEST_F()
/foundation/multimedia/audio_framework/frameworks/native/hdiadapter/source/primary/
H A Daudio_capturer_source.cpp160 int32_t GetPresentationPosition(uint64_t& frames, int64_t& timeSec, int64_t& timeNanoSec) override;
294 int32_t GetPresentationPosition(uint64_t& frames, int64_t& timeSec, int64_t& timeNanoSec) override;
1296 int32_t AudioCapturerSourceInner::GetPresentationPosition(uint64_t& frames, int64_t& timeSec, int64_t& timeNanoSec) in GetPresentationPosition() argument
1318 timeNanoSec = timestamp.tvNSec; in GetPresentationPosition()
1852 int32_t AudioCapturerSourceWakeup::GetPresentationPosition(uint64_t& frames, int64_t& timeSec, int64_t& timeNanoSec) in GetPresentationPosition() argument
1854 return audioCapturerSource_.GetPresentationPosition(frames, timeSec, timeNanoSec); in GetPresentationPosition()
/foundation/multimedia/audio_framework/frameworks/native/hdiadapter/source/remote/
H A Dremote_audio_capturer_source.cpp85 int32_t GetPresentationPosition(uint64_t& frames, int64_t& timeSec, int64_t& timeNanoSec) override;
678 int64_t& timeNanoSec) in GetPresentationPosition()
677 GetPresentationPosition(uint64_t& frames, int64_t& timeSec, int64_t& timeNanoSec) GetPresentationPosition() argument
/foundation/multimedia/audio_framework/frameworks/native/hdiadapter/sink/multichannel/
H A Dmultichannel_audio_renderer_sink.cpp93 int32_t GetPresentationPosition(uint64_t& frames, int64_t& timeSec, int64_t& timeNanoSec) override;
368 int32_t MultiChannelRendererSinkInner::GetPresentationPosition(uint64_t& frames, int64_t& timeSec, int64_t& timeNanoSec) in GetPresentationPosition() argument
/foundation/multimedia/audio_framework/frameworks/native/hdiadapter/sink/remote/
H A Dremote_audio_renderer_sink.cpp116 int32_t GetPresentationPosition(uint64_t& frames, int64_t& timeSec, int64_t& timeNanoSec) override;
919 int32_t RemoteAudioRendererSinkInner::GetPresentationPosition(uint64_t& frames, int64_t& timeSec, int64_t& timeNanoSec) in GetPresentationPosition() argument

Completed in 30 milliseconds

12